CN DeSoto Avenue Bridge

Concrete Arch Bridge over DeSoto Avenue
Loveland, Pottawattamie County, Iowa

Name CN DeSoto Avenue Bridge
Built By Illinois Central Railroad
Contractor Unknown
Currently Owned By Canadian National Railway
Length 18 Feet Total
Width 1 Track
Height Above Ground 11 Feet 1 Inch
Superstructure Type Concrete Arch
Substructure Type Concrete
Date Built 1907
Traffic Count 2 Trains/Day (Estimated)
Current Status In Use
CN Bridge Number 495.04
Significance Local Significance
Documentation Date October 2015


This simple concrete arch bridge crosses DeSoto Avenue, near Loveland.
The bridge is a very simple construction. It is a simple concrete arch, with a narrow passageway. This could lead to the eventual replacement of the structure.
The bridge sits right next to Loess Hills Trail, making it an easy access. It also is off of exit #72 from I-29.

The bridge appears to be in fair to good condition. The author has marked this bridge as being locally significant, due to the common design. The photo above is an overview.
